EXECUTIVE ASSISTANT
M Benefit SolutionsTM
DEPARTMENT M Benefit Solutions – Consulting Services and Actuarial Departments
SUMMARY This position is responsible for providing administrative support to the
Consulting Services and Actuarial teams.
RESPONSIBILITIES • Maintain calendars, schedule meetings, prepare or gather
meeting materials and assist with follow-up from meetings and
conference calls
• Produce and bind reports for client meetings
• Make complex multi-trip travel and hotel arrangements in a cost-
efficient manner; prepare all necessary information and materials
related to the trip
• Promptly process expense reports and monthly AMEX or other
credit card reconciliations
• Draft and edit correspondence, reports, memos, emails, meeting
minutes and other written materials
• Answer telephone calls and respond appropriately and proactively to
varying issues
• Assist with coordination of meetings and convention
participation for M Benefit Solutions and joint venture
partners including shipment of exhibit booths and marketing
materials
• Conduct ‘intelligence’ research on corporate and bank
prospects for marketers and joint venture partners
• Post documents to corporate, bank and joint venture websites

QUALIFICATIONS • High School diploma or equivalent; Bachelor’s degree
preferred
• Minimum two years’ progressively responsible, relevant
experience as an Executive Assistant at a mid- to senior- level
• Proficiency with a PC and a variety of software applications and
database management (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int)
• Excellent verbal and written communication skills
• Proven ability to track, prioritize and report status of multiple
projects
• Exceptional organization and problem solving skills, with the ability
to follow through
• Ability to build rapport with internal and external contacts
• Ability to work independently as well as in a team environment
• Proven ability to work with changing requirements/priorities
using internal/external peer resources
• Detail-oriented, proactive, self-motivated and responsible
JOB CONDITIONS AND
ENVIRONMENT
• Normal office environment/desk assignment
• Extensive use of PCs, computer terminal, display, keyboard, and
mouse
• Extensive close work with documents, publications, databases,
spreadsheets, presentation materials and other software
